    Default Easy controlled slides on soft wheels?

    Ok. Heres my strainge request.

    I want a board that i can slide to control speed. carve like a mainiac and be super fast on the flats...oh and also i need to use soft wheels because a good part of my commuting is on rough footpath and i hate the feel of hard as hell wheels.

    I have a freeboard which obviously slides real easy but its a pain in the arse on the flat.
    my flowboard is to damn slow on the flat.

    i have a soul four longboard with 76mm 78 kryptos on but sliding those puppies is madness.

    anyone got an idea of board or board setup that will be good for me????

    An idea i've had is the super soft wheel but machining the width down so theres less surface area. This way i should be able to slide easier and still have a smooth ride!?

    Any comments??

    PS the roads i slide on are smooth..... its the commuting to and from the roads thats harsh.

    i've been experimenting with the biggest rollerblade wheels i can find (in a 75a duro) . the baord goes crazy fast for communting, and still has a super smooth, minimal vibration ride.

    the wheels are dirt cheap too... got em for 6 bucks from a used sporting goods shop.

    something to try, you can never have too many wheels....
